    Memória e performance: por uma educação sensível em processos de ensino/aprendizagem artes
    (Universidade Federal do Pará, 2020-12-14) MODESTO, Amanda Nascimento; BEZERRA, José Denis de Oliveira; http://lattes.cnpq.br/9404514273838260
    The present master's research discusses experiences that emerge from the encounter between memory and performance, both in the theoretical-methodological field, as in research practice, and in its relations with art teaching. In this work, we seek to understand the classroom space as a place for the formation of sensibilities, based on experiences with art, especially performance as language, understanding the classroom as a liminoíde space and education itself as a performative act. Thus, the main objective of this work is to reflect on the experiences of training and interaction carried out with three classes of elementary school in a public school in the neighborhood of Guamá, in Belém-PA, and to analyze them in the context of discussions of studies of the memory as a potentializing place for subjects and their life stories, their narratives, their life and art experiences. We have as a theoretical-methodological field the socalled research-action (TRIPP, 2005) that started from bibliographic research, and also autobiographical, when proposing the discussion of concepts of memory, guided by authors like Halbwachs (1994) that initiates the discussions about memory being a social and communicative function, Pollak (1992) and Assman (2011), when they propose reflections on the socio-cultural meanings of places and forms of memories, silencing and on the cultural experiences of social subjects; and performance studies, such as Schechener (1985) and Icle (2017), which analyze and reflect on the performative language and its plural dimensions. In this way, this work reveals the importance of developing pedagogical practices in and with art, in the involvement with stories, reminiscences, life experiences in their individual and collective dimensions, contemplated in performative pedagogy; and that reveal the strength of an educational process that happens through the co-participation of the subjects involved, marking an important territory, the School, a space for the experimentation of the most diverse languages, including the artistic that, when worked through sensitive teaching processes / learning, become powerful in the scenario of transformations that lives the education and the schooling process in contemporary times
